Niall McNamee is a singer songwriter with a modern twist on his Irish heritage, mixing the best of Celtic post-punk passion with a 21st Century alt rock perspective. Think Shane McGowan in a writing room with Dolores O’Riordan, Chris Martin and Alex Turner.

McNamee’s songwriting highlights his storytelling, while his charismatic live performances are rapidly growing his reputation with audiences. 2024 saw sold-out headline shows in London (twice), Bury, Bristol, Glasgow, Birmingham and Dublin plus supports for The WolfeTones in Finsbury Park and Louis Dunford.

 

A perfect introduction to this rising London-based artist, ‘Clapham Wine’ (Feb 2025, the first single from the forthcoming debut album) showcases a whole lot of indie attitude, mixed with a little bit of Irish trad, delivered with huge energy and charm.

    Niall McNamee is an Irish singer-songwriter and actor rapidly making a name for himself through his captivating songwriting and charismatic live performances.

    Describing himself as ‘a romantic football fan who writes songs’, Niall moved to London at 17 years old working on building sites whilst growing a devoted fan base playing gigs in pubs and venues across London. He began his acting career in London’s West End as Romeo in ‘Romeo and Juliet’ before moving into film and TV, starring opposite Pierce Brosnan and having a major fight scene with Jackie Chan in ‘The Foreigner’.  He took the lead in award-winning feature film ‘Love Without Walls’, for which he also wrote the original soundtrack.
